site stats

Date format syntax in sas

WebA second set of tools, SAS date/time formats, modify the external representation of a SAS date or time variable. As with other SAS System formats, a date, time or datetime format displays ... This statement creates a new SAS date variable representing the number of days between January 1, 1960 and the first day of the month in which WebJun 16, 2024 · NOTE: DATA statement used (Total process time): real time 0.01 seconds cpu time 0.01 seconds If you need to use the value in pass through SQL code then you will need to set the macro variable to text that the remote database's implementation of SQL will recognize as a datetime value.

Date, Time, and Datetime Formats - SAS

WebAug 22, 2024 · data intnx_ex; date=today(); firstday=intnx('month', date , 0); format date firstday date9.; run; INTNX Function in SAS for the end of the month. The day before the following month’s first day is the current month’s last day. Dates in SAS are stored as the number of days since a certain point, so take one away. WebMar 12, 2024 · Syntax: FORMAT variable-name <$>FORMAT-NAME.; $ → indicates a character format; its absence indicates a numeric format. SAS Format always contains a period (.) as a part of the name. Default values are used if you omit the format’s w and the d values. The d value you specify with SAS formats indicates the number of decimal places. greenhill \u0026 co. inc. internship https://qtproductsdirect.com

SAS Date Formats: How To Display Dates Correctly?

WebNov 4, 2016 · proc sql; create table want as select input (put (date,yymmddn8.),8.) as date_num from have; quit; input (..) turns something into a number, put (..) turns something into a string. In this case, we first put it with your desired format ( yymmddn8. is YYYYMMDD with no separator), and then input it with 8., which is the length of the string … WebNov 17, 2024 · The easiest way to convert a datetime to a date in SAS is to use the DATEPART function. This function uses the following basic syntax: date = put (datepart (some_datetime), mmddyy10.); The argument mmddyy10. specifies that the date should be formatted like 10/15/2024. The following example shows how to use this syntax in practice. WebThe DATE w. format writes SAS date values in the form ddmmmyy, ddmmmyyyy, or dd-mmm-yyyy. Here is an explanation of the syntax: Here is an explanation of the syntax: dd greenhill twyford

Working with Dates in the SAS System: Entering Dates :: Step-by-Step ...

Category:Date Format ddmmmyyyy in SAS - theprogrammingexpert.com

Tags:Date format syntax in sas

Date format syntax in sas

Is there a function in SAS that can convert a day of the year to a date?

WebJan 27, 2024 · SAS Syntax (*.sas) Syntax to read the CSV-format sample data and set variable labels and formats/value labels. What are Informats and Formats? ... If you do not supply a format for a date variable, SAS …

Date format syntax in sas

Did you know?

WebJan 7, 2024 · This function uses the following basic syntax: date_var = input (character_var, MMDDYY10.); format date_var MMDDYY10.; The following example … WebMar 18, 1993 · pyspark.sql.functions.date_format(date: ColumnOrName, format: str) → pyspark.sql.column.Column [source] ¶. Converts a date/timestamp/string to a value of string in the format specified by the date format given by the second argument. A pattern could be for instance dd.MM.yyyy and could return a string like ‘18.03.1993’.

WebJan 27, 2024 · Select Create a date/time variable from a string containing a date or time. Then click Next. In the Variables box, select variable enrolldate. This will show a preview of the values of the variable in the Sample Values box, so that you can select the correct pattern. In the Patterns box, click dd-mmm-yyyy. Web77 rows · Various SAS language elements handle SAS date values: functions, formats, …

WebFirst, review the INPUT statement and the corresponding forms of the April 10, 2008 date in the DATALINES statement. Again, the width of the ddmmyy informat (6, 8, or 10) tells SAS what form of the date it should expect. The "d" that appears in the format for the date1 variable tells SAS to display dashes between the month, day and year.The "n" that … WebAug 14, 2012 · A format affects how SAS displays a variable value. It does not affect the actual value itself. So, assuming the variable CREATION_DATE is a datetime value, just assign it a format of DATETIME20. to display is as you want: proc sql; create table data.test as select ID, CREATION_DATE format=datetime20. from connection to odbc ( select ID, …

WebDec 23, 2024 · Like numeric formats, SAS Base offers many date formats. See here a list of the most common ways to display dates. SAS dates might be confusing. Sometimes …

Web8 rows · The DATE w. format writes SAS date values in the form ddmmmyy, ddmmmyyyy, or dd-mmm-yyyy, where. dd. is an integer that represents the day of the month. mmm. is the first three letters of the month name. yy or yyyy. is a two-digit or four-digit integer that … Syntax DATE w. Syntax Description w. specifies the width of the output field. … Syntax Description. w. specifies the width of the output field. Default: 8: Range: 2-10: … Syntax Description w. specifies the width of the input field. ... Note: SAS interprets a … greenhill \\u0026 co wsoWebJan 30, 2024 · It is NOT a SAS date variable (remember, SAS date variables are the number of days since 1/1/60 and November 23, 2024 is 21876) You can convert this to … greenhill \u0026 co summer internshipWebDate Formats While date formats are still a form of numeric formats, they only work with variables that SAS recognizes as dates to begin with. One example of a date format is MMDDYYw. Depending on the width used, the MMDDYYw format can convert dates to look like mm/dd/yy with a width of 8 or look like mm/dd/yyyy with a width of 10 applied. greenhill \u0026 co nycWebSome of the SAS date and datetime formats commonly used to write out SAS date and datetime values are listed in Table 4.3 and Table 4.4. A width value can be specified with … greenhill\u0027s financing usaWebDec 23, 2024 · Like numeric formats, SAS Base offers many date formats. See here a list of the most common ways to display dates. SAS dates might be confusing. Sometimes a value looks like a date but isn’t a real SAS date. This can happen on two occasions: A number looks like a date, e.g. 01012024 (January 1st, 2024), or greenhill\\u0027s financing usaWebAug 13, 2012 · A format affects how SAS displays a variable value. It does not affect the actual value itself. So, assuming the variable CREATION_DATE is a datetime value, just … flw worksWeb2 days ago · Is there a function that exists that can convert this day value to a date value mm/dd/2024 ? I know how to do this with "hard coding" and using conditional logic/basic arithmetic or writing my own format, but I wanted to … green hill university archive of our own